"Our greatest wish is for thriving Turkey-Greece relations," says Turkey's EU Minister Mevlut Cavusoglu
ATHENS
Turkey's EU Minister urges for progression in Turkey and Greece relations Friday in Athens.
Mevlut Cavusoglu stressed the importance of dialogue between the two countries after his meeting with Greek Parliament Speaker Evangelos Meimarakis in Athens on the sidelines of the EU foreign ministers informal meeting, and said "Our greatest wish is for the thriving of Turkey-Greece relations."
EU foreign ministers gathered in Athens Friday for a two-day informal meeting to discuss regional developments; mainly the Syria and Ukraine crisis.
Cavusoglu expressed gratitude to Greece for its support to Turkey's EU accession and acknowledged that Greece has other priorities to deal with other than Turkey's accession during its rotating six-month EU presidency.
Meimarakis said he was "hosting Cavusoglu as a friend." and added, "We prove here with this meeting that both countries, despite having some disputes, can hold talks in a democratic way."
Greece and Turkey have had disputes over territorial waters, airspace in the Aegean Sea, and the 40-year-old Cyprus dispute between the Turkish and Greek Cypriots.
